If you put it into a package, then you could have your own object module that then isn't at the top level - e.g. mypkg/object.d with module mypkg.object; but you can't have more than one module in your program with the same full module name. So, in the case of the top-level module, object, you can only declare your own if you replace the default one, which you might do in some special situations, but it's not something that you would normally do, and you can never have both the normal object module and your own in the same program. - Jonathan M Davis
